Because Vietnam has a lot to offer, this tour will offer you a lot. A wellness tour in Vietnam while enjoying the sweetness of life in Vietnam. Discover the North and the Center, a mixture of landscapes, history and culture. Share moments with the locals and discover local crafts. A trip mixing mountains, rice fields, jungle, waterfall and beach to contemplate the multiple riches of the land of the dragon.

After the frenetic Hanoi, a sweet break in the sublime Avana Retreat in the province of Hoa Binh. Perfectly integrated into the landscape, this 5-star resort is an example in terms of sustainable development. Perfect place for a well-being break, whether by visiting a Hmong village or participating in relaxation activities near the waterfall, you will come out with a feeling of inner plenitude. The rest of the trip to the Pu Luong Nature Reserve will prolong this effect with its landscapes and tranquility.

Finally, visit Halong Bay on land as well as the private traditional junk cruise in the fabulous and legendary Lan Ha Bay. The sweetness of life in Vietnam opens its arms to you for a rejuvenating stay!

  • Day 2 > Hanoi
  • duong-lam_smallDeparture for the local market of Ngoc Ha followed by a fresh fruit juice around Lake B52. Explanation on this place steeped in history due to the carcass of the American fighter plane emerging from the water. Passing through small alleys teeming with life, we reach the Mausoleum of Ho Chi Minh, a sacred place in Vietnam. After lunch at a local restaurant, head to the Ethnology Museum to learn about the history and customs of minorities living in Vietnam. Then head to Trang Quoc Pagoda , located between West Lake, the city's largest lake, and the charming Truc Bach Lake. After this cultural day, it's time to relax for a body massage and a two-hour facial treatment. Gastronomic tour in the Old Quarter to revel in local flavors. Night at the hotel in the Old Quarter.

  • Day 7 > Ninh Binh
  • The most enjoyable way to appreciate the beauty and tranquility of Halong Bay on land is to hop on a bicycle and slowly admire the scenery and local life. The bike ride will first lead to Tam Coc to cruise aboard a sampan, a traditional boat. You will navigate between the karstic peaks and will probably be surprised to see the boatwoman rowing with her feet. Try the experience! Back on the bike, we will continue to Mua Cave. You can visit the cave but the major interest of the site remains to climb up to the dragon temple to contemplate the most beautiful view of the valley. It will be time for lunch at a local restaurant and back to the hotel. The afternoon will be devoted to the discovery of local crafts by visiting the villages of Ninh Van, Phu Loc and Bo Bat. After this long day, you will be welcomed to the hotel Spa for a back and shoulder massage. You will be ready to sit down to eat and enjoy a peaceful night.

  • Day 9 > Halong Bay – Hanoi – Hue
  • Early in the morning before lunch, try your hand at a Tai Chi class on the upper pontoon. The cruise continues with the visit of the isolated village of Viet Hai. This fishing village is only accessible by sea or a long walk through Cat Ba National Park. You will learn the history of Halong Bay and the making of rice wine. A tasting will be offered. During the drive back to Halong pontoon , brunch will be served. Upon arrival, you will be picked up by the vehicle to return to Hanoi. Break at the ecotourism village of Yen duc on the way. Arrived in Hanoi for dinner before taking the night train to the former capital of Vietnam, Hue.
